Abstract

The invention relates to a photovoltaic module, comprising a plurality of solar cells (1), which have fronts that are exposed to solar radiation and backs, wherein a first solar cell (1) or a first group of solar cells (1) is connected via the backs thereof to a front of a first section of an electrically conductive heat conductor (4), and at least one further solar cell (1) or a further group of solar cells (1) is connected via the backs thereof to the front of a further section of the electrically conductive heat conductor (4), wherein said electrically conductive heat conductor (4) is connected via a heat-conducting but electrically insulating layer (5) to a base plate (6, 7), the fronts of the first solar cells (1) or group of solar cells (1) being electrically connected to the front of the further section of the electrically conductive heat conductor (4). According to the invention, the first solar cell (1) or group of solar cells (1) is connected to the further section of the electrically conductive heat conductor (4) by wedge bonding.
